设计模式 关于设计模式:观察者模式与发布订阅模式区别-JS 在观察者模式中,只有两种主体:指标对象 (Subject) 和 观察者 (Observer)。在观察者模式中,Subject 对象领有增加、删除和告诉一系列 Observer 的办法等,而 Observer 对象领有 update 更新办法等。在 Subject 对象增加了一系列 Observer 对象之后,Subject 对象则维持着这一系列 Observer 对象,当无关状态产生变更时 …
设计模式 关于设计模式:重学Java设计模式作者开始录视频了 作者:小傅哥博客:[链接]积淀、分享、成长,让本人和别人都能有所播种!😄1. 前言哈哈哈,终于对B站下手了!大家好,我是小傅哥,在缓和、羞涩到适应后,哈哈哈,终于开始承受视频里传出本人的西南茬子声音。所以我决定开始在B站搞事(内卷启动):全面铺设技术学习视频,让干货内容往前挤一挤!相熟小傅哥的都晓得,小傅…
设计模式 关于设计模式:设计模式二三事 设计模式是泛滥软件开发人员通过长时间的试错和利用总结进去的,解决特定问题的一系列计划。现行的局部教材在介绍设计模式时,有些会因为案例脱离实际利用场景而令人费解,有些又会因为场景简略而显得有些小题大做。本文会联合在美团金融服务平台设计开发时的教训,结合实际的案例,并采纳“师生对话”这种绝对滑稽的模式…
设计模式 关于设计模式:重新学习设计模式一什么是设计模式 始终以来,设计模式是一个令人头疼的课题,记得之前在A公司做智能客服我的项目时,刚开始只是一个小我的项目,不论什么设计模式,零碎架构,全程间接上手敲业务代码,两三天工夫就把所有的代码敲完上线应用,后果谁也没想到忽然我的项目大起来了,十几个业务部门的业务一拥而上,开始招人,上手业务,后果。。。大家都是苦力干嘛,拼…
设计模式 关于设计模式:JAVA-23种设计模式详解 这种类型的设计模式属于创立型模式,它提供了一种创建对象的最佳形式。这种模式波及到一个繁多的类,该类负责创立本人的对象,同时确保只有单个对象被创立。这个类提供了一种拜访其惟一的对象的形式,能够间接拜访,不须要实例化该类的对象。
设计模式 关于设计模式:轻松搞懂设计模式观察者模式 观察者(Observer)模式的定义:指多个对象间存在一对多的依赖关系,当一个对象的状态产生扭转时,所有依赖于它的对象都失去告诉并被自动更新。这种模式有时又称作公布-订阅模式、模型-视图模式,它是对象行为型模式。
设计模式 关于设计模式:设计模式之桥接模式 在 GoF 的《设计模式》一书中,桥接模式被定义为:“将形象和实现解耦,让它们能够独立变动。”定义中的“形象”,指的并非“抽象类”或“接口”,而是被形象进去的一套“类库”,它只蕴含骨架代码,真正的业务逻辑须要委派给定义中的“实现”来实现。而定义中的“实现”,也并非“接口的实现类”,而是一套独立的“类库”。
设计模式 关于设计模式:设计模式之代理模式 代理模式是一种结构型设计模式。结构型模式次要总结了一些类或对象组合在一起的经典构造,这些经典的构造能够解决特定利用场景的问题。结构型模式包含:代理模式、桥接模式、装璜器模式、适配器模式、门面模式、组合模式、享元模式。
设计模式 关于设计模式:设计模式之原型模式 如果 对象的创立老本比拟大,而 同一个类的不同对象之间差异不大(大部分字段都雷同),在这种状况下,咱们能够利用对已有对象(原型)进行复制(或者叫拷贝)的形式来创立新对象,以达到节俭创立工夫的目标。